Clark A. Tchernowitz v. Gardens at Clearwater

Court of Appeals of Texas·Decided June 2, 2016·No. 04-15-00716-CV·Published

Opinion

Fourth Court of Appeals San Antonio, Texas June 2, 2016

No. 04-15-00716-CV

Clark A. TCHERNOWITZ, Appellant

v.

GARDENS AT CLEARWATER, Appellee

From the County Court at Law, Kerr County, Texas Trial Court No. 15542C Honorable Susan Harris, Judge Presiding

ORDER The Appellee’s Motion for Extension of Time to File Brief is GRANTED. NO FURTHER EXTENSIONS OF TIME WILL BE ALLOWED. If Appellee’s brief is not received on or before June 20, 2016, the case will be set “at issue” and will proceed without Appellee’s brief.
